Steps to reproduce:

1) Make sure your account is not configured to check new email every x minutes. If it is, unconfigure it and restart kmail.
2) Now, configure again your account to check email every one minute.
3) Minimize to the system tray.
4) Send an email to yourself using some other client or webmail application.
5) Wait for one minute. KMail does not fetch the new email.
6) Use check mail to actually get the email and restart kmail
7) Repeat steps 3 and 4. Now kmail fetches the new email after one minute. (which means, a restart of kmail is required, although it shouldn't)

I have seen this behavior with both POP3 and IMAP accounts.
